All dimensions are in inches [millimeters]. 2. Standard tolerance: ±0.010" unless otherwise noted. Bivar Surface Mount 0603 package LED may be used in nearly any lighting or indication application. The miniature package is ideal for small scale applications such as general indication and backlighting. Low power consumption and excellent long life reliability are suitable for battery powered equipment. Bivar offers water clear LED lens for maximum luminous intensity. Wide variety of wavelength and intensity combinations are available to meet any illumination need. The SM0603 LED is packaged in standard tape and reels for pick and place assemblies.

Temperature at tip of iron: 300 ̊C Max. (25W Max.) 2. Soldering time: 5 ± 1 sec. Precautions For Use 1. Customer must apply resistors for protection and stability. Using Circuit B in the diagram below is recommended. Using Circuit A can result in LED burnout. 2. Current change may lead to LED color change. If there is a large difference between the spectral color separation current and actual service current, a color difference may occur. 3. Utilize forward current for LED operation. Subjecting the LED to continuous reverse voltage may cause damage to the die. Handling Precautions 1. When handling the product with tweezers, be careful to not damage the resin. The resin can be cut, chipped, delaminated, or deformed, which can lead to wire-bond breaks. 2. Reflow soldering must not be performed more than twice. Hand soldering must not be performed more than once. 3. When soldering, do not put stress on the LEDs during heating. 4. LEDs are sensitive to static electricity or voltage surges. ESD can damage a die and its reliability. 5. Do not stack assembled PCBs together. When stacked, PCBs with soldered LEDs can damage the resin surrounding the die, leading to failure.
